> Dear Chris, LF Group,
>
>= ; The signal disappeared some time around 1520utc - the complete trace is= shown in the attachment.
>
> I made an estimate of the field strength of your signal by in= jecting a test signal at a known EMF into the loop antenna, and comparing= with the level of your signal. The received FS at the strongest point (ar= ound 1330utc) worked out to be 1.8uV/m. Taking the distance between our lo= cations as 37km, your ERP would have been 87uW. The SNR at best was around= 15dB, making the noise level 0.32uV/m in the FFT noise bandwidth of 2.1mH= z, or a noise density of 7uV/m per sqrt(Hz)
>
> Assuming a 50m vertical wire (heff ~ 25m), =A0Rrad of your an= tenna at 8.97kHz would be 880micro-ohms. Assuming 2.62dB directivity for= an electrically short monopole compared to a dipole, and Iant of 200mA,= the calculated value of ERP would then be 64uW. So there is reasonable ag= reement between these two calculations, the difference only being 1.3dB. >
